Existe-t-il une interface Web d'administration Mercurial? [fermé]

10

Quelque chose comme Bitbucket (bien sûr beaucoup moins riche en fonctionnalités). Il doit pouvoir contenir plusieurs référentiels et être privé (c'est-à-dire que si vous ne vous connectez pas, il ne vous montre rien).

Il devrait pouvoir fonctionner sur un serveur Linux, et s'il est également facile à configurer (comme phpMyAdmin), ce serait bien sûr mieux.

phpHgAdmin semble abandonné et n'a même pas de site Web, et les autres que j'ai vus mentionnés ne semblent pas très prometteurs. C'est généralement un signe que "ça n'existe pas", mais peut-être que je n'ai pas assez bien cherché.

o0 '.
la source

Réponses:

6

Gestionnaire SCM :

Le moyen le plus simple de partager et de gérer vos référentiels Git, Mercurial et Subversion via http.

  • Installation très simple
  • Pas besoin de pirater les fichiers de configuration, SCM-Manager est entièrement configurable depuis son interface Web
  • Aucun Apache et aucune installation de base de données n'est requis
  • Gestion centralisée des utilisateurs, des groupes et des autorisations
  • Prise en charge de Git, Mercurial et Subversion
  • API de service Web RESTFul complète (JSON et XML)
  • Interface utilisateur riche
  • API de plugin simple
  • Plugins utiles disponibles (par exemple Ldap-, ActiveDirectory-, PAM-Authentication)
alexandrul
la source
Semble très intéressant, beaucoup plus poli que le rhodecode ... Je vais l'essayer, merci!
o0 '.
Il est également plus simple à configurer que RhodeCode, car SCM-Manager est un peu autonome: ajoutez simplement java et vous avez terminé.
alexandrul
5

RhodeCode est un excellent outil de type Bitbucket que vous pouvez installer vous-même.

J'aime ça: il est en cours de développement mais est déjà très complet. Je l'ai récemment installé pour un client et ils voient de bonnes performances avec. Ils sont ~ 65 développeurs et ont ~ 50 machines dans une ferme de build qui tirent du serveur RhodeCode.

Martin Geisler
la source
(dommage que je n'ai pas réussi à installer sur OSX, cependant)
o0 '.
1
Veuillez contacter les développeurs RhodeCode sur leur liste de diffusion normale - c'est une bien meilleure façon de demander de l'aide.
Martin Geisler
1

De nos jours, Phabricator ressemble à une bonne solution - apparemment, vous pouvez désactiver tous les modules que vous ne voulez pas, tels que la révision de code, wiki, etc.

BCran
la source